07 - Fire Safety › N/A - No Subsystem › Fire detection and alarm system
Issued 24 February 2021Resolved
07106 - Fire Safety - The function of fixed fire detection and fire alarm systems shall be periodically tested to the satisfaction of the administration by means of equipment producing hot air at the appropriate temperature. PSCO observed crew using heat gun to conduct test of heat detectors. 74 SOLAS 20 con. II-2/7.3.2 - 10c
Action required: 10 - Deficiency Rectified
Due 24 February 2021
Resolved 24 February 2021
Resolution: Crew provided proper testing equipment for fire detection system.
